2 Samuel 18:7 — Bible Verse (KJV)

“Where the people of Israel were slain before the servants of David, and there was there a great slaughter that day of twenty thousand men.”

2 Samuel 18:7 WEB — World English Bible (2000)

“The people of Israel were struck there before David’s servants, and there was a great slaughter there that day of twenty thousand men.”

2 Samuel 18:7 ASV — American Standard Version (1901)

“And the people of Israel were smitten there before the servants of David, and there was a great slaughter there that day of twenty thousand men.”

2 Samuel 18:7 YLT — Young's Literal Translation (1862)

“and smitten there are the people of Israel before the servants of David, and the smiting there is great on that day--twenty thousand;”

2 Samuel 18:7 DBY — Darby Translation (1890)

“And the people of Israel were routed before the servants of David, and there was a great slaughter there that day: twenty thousand men.”

2 Samuel 18:7 GEN — Geneva Bible (1599)

“Where the people of Israel were slaine before the seruants of Dauid: so there was a great slaughter that day, euen of twentie thousande.”
